Java Hibernation Package is an experimental implementation of Java thread serialization mechanism based on the Java Platform Debugger Architecture (JPDA). It is designed to support serialization of synchronizing multiple threads.
(serial ports on) steroids enables users to execute remote c functions in python shell over serial interface. It generates c code for the target and a python script for the host automatically from a c header file.
Python / GTK / GNOME applet for wireless configuration, similar to Windows XP "Zeroconf" wireless. Shows network status, available access points, and allows the user to connect to a specific AP. Stores WEP keys and handles DHCP.

DefconfigManager is too to generate consistent Linux Kernel defconfig for different architectures and machines. It is based Kconfiglib, Python library to parse Kconfig's and defconfigs.
We provide ported opensource tools/applications including their complete sources and/or ready to use binaries for QNX, like XFree86, Lesstif, DDD, VNC, Nedit and cluster middleware like PVM.
MOST4Linux provides a MOST kernel driver supporting synchronous data transfer for PCI hardware and userspace programs to test the driver. The driver can be compiled for Linux 2.6 or for the RTDM which works for the real-time extensions RTAI and Xenomai.

Battery Life Tool Kit is a set of scripts and programs to monitor and log power consumption of Linux laptops/notebooks under different workloads. Set of reference workloads is included in the Tool Kit

Intronet is a light weighted framework which allows user to work with remote Linux system and to do some administration tasks using web browser. It's fully usable in browsers at mobile devices such pda, modern cell phones, etc.
Python DB driver for Java JDBC. Allows CPython programs to use a java JDBC driver to connect with a database server. It's API is Python DB compliant. ZJdbcDA (a zope database adapter) is also included.
OpenMMOd is a open-source event-driven MMORPG Server written in C++ with a YAML packet definition backend. It is MySQL database driven currently with future backend support to come in the future.

Monpy provides a framework for pluggable computer monitoring - either locally or remotely, via a network. The network protocol is JSON based, so easily parseable in many programming languages.
